In addition, bilateral superior laryngeal nerve blocks were performed. A 7.0-mm internal diameter endotracheal tube (ETT) was pre-mounted over the fibrescope. Flexible fibrescopy was done via the left nostril with a continuous flow of 3 L·min –1 oxygen through the suction port. It required 40 sec for maneuvering the fibrescope to visualize the carina. While the ETT could not be railroaded on the first attempt, a slight rotation of the ETT and a deep breath facilitated its correct placement in the trachea. The whole procedure took about 100 sec, with the patient remaining awake and responsive to command throughout. During the awake intubation, the patient’s SpO 2 remained between 97% and 99%. The heart rate varied from 88 to 96 beats·min –1 and maximum systolic blood pressure was 124 mmHg, a rise of 16 mmHg from the immediate pre-fibrescopy value. The next day, the patient described his experience of fibrescopy procedure as only mildly uncomfortable.
